💻 Leveraging Digital Tools
The digital landscape offers a plethora of tools that can enhance creativity and facilitate innovation. From design software to data analytics platforms, these tools empower individuals to bring their ideas to life. Selecting the right tools is paramount.
Here are some examples of digital tools that can be leveraged:
- Design Software: Adobe Creative Suite, Canva, Figma
- Collaboration Platforms: Slack, Microsoft Teams, Trello
- Data Analytics Tools: Google Analytics, Tableau, Power BI
- Marketing Automation: HubSpot, Mailchimp, Marketo
Mastering these tools can significantly enhance productivity and creativity. It allows for the efficient execution of ideas and the ability to analyze data to inform decision-making. Continuous learning and adaptation are crucial in this ever-evolving digital environment.

💰 Monetizing Digital Creativity
Once a creative business idea has been developed, the next step is to monetize it effectively. This involves developing a sustainable business model and implementing strategies to generate revenue. Careful planning is essential.
Here are some common monetization strategies:
- Subscription Model: Providing ongoing access to products or services for a recurring fee.
- Freemium Model: Offering a basic version for free and charging for premium features.
- E-commerce: Selling products online through a dedicated store.
- Advertising: Generating revenue through online advertisements.
The choice of monetization strategy depends on the nature of the business and the target market. It’s crucial to carefully consider the pros and cons of each approach and select the one that is most likely to generate sustainable revenue. A flexible approach is often beneficial.
